Spain will be the guest of honor at 'Emprende Tu Mente Day' (EtM Day), Latin America's largest event connecting investors and entrepreneurs. The event is scheduled to take place in Santiago, Chile, in November.
Spanish Ambassador to Chile, Laura Oroz, announced the participation, expressing gratitude for the presence of "wonderful Spanish entrepreneurship" in Chile. She stated that Spain aims to showcase its success in building an innovation ecosystem, supported by public policy and private enterprise.
EtM Day seeks to connect startups with funding, mainly from private investors. The event is expected to draw over 60,000 attendees to the Parque Bicentenario. Daniel Daccarett, co-founder of the organizing foundation, called Spain's participation "impressive," noting Spain's significant investment in Chile. He believes EtM Day, currently the largest entrepreneurship event in Latin America, could soon become the world's largest.
Ambassador Oroz views the event as an opportunity to reinforce the excellent bilateral relationship between Chile and Spain and to highlight Spain's public investment strategy. She emphasized that innovation and entrepreneurship are key drivers of development and wealth creation, a focus that has been increasingly supported by both public initiatives and the private sector.
